The Hidden Thirst: Why Seniors Need to Drink Up
As we age, our bodies play a sneaky trick on us – they start to lose the ability to signal thirst effectively. Dr. Emily Watkins, a geriatric specialist at Austin Senior Health Center, explains, “Older adults often don’t feel thirsty even when their bodies are crying out for fluids. This makes intentional hydration crucial, especially during exercise.” This physiological change, combined with the effects of certain medications, can create a perfect storm for dehydration.
Hydration: The Unsung Hero of Senior Fitness
Proper hydration isn’t just about quenching thirst – it’s the backbone of a successful fitness routine. Like oil in a well-oiled machine, water keeps your body running smoothly during exercise. It regulates body temperature, cushions joints, and helps transport nutrients to hard-working muscles. Hydration Hacks: Making Water Work for You
Drinking enough water doesn’t have to be a chore. Try these creative approaches to stay hydrated:
- Infuse water with fresh fruits or herbs for a flavor boost
- Set hydration alarms on your phone or fitness tracker
- Eat water-rich foods like cucumbers, watermelon, and leafy greens

The Telltale Signs: Are You Drinking Enough?
Your body has ways of telling you it needs more water. Look out for these Hydration Warning Signs in Older Adults, such as dark urine, dry mouth, or sudden fatigue during workouts. These could be your body’s SOS signals for hydration!
